Transaction fb8f08419a766cd078c8ec20f7d5659106e5698866a1baf65ce1689a566c385e
1 Input
1 Output
-
fb8f08419a766cd078c8ec20f7d5659106e5698866a1baf65ce1689a566c385e:0
- value
- 402498490
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 34f580082ec558de2a5ccd92d13916718a126fdf OP_EQUALVERIFY OP_CHECKSIG
- address
- LQ3yVqSFszpDSEBACFtXFHboSXAbnFRcwn